Q: Is 1,125,534 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,125,534 is a composite number.

Why is 1,125,534 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,125,534 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 109 218 327 654 1,721 3,442 5,163 10,326 187,589 375,178 562,767 and 1,125,534, with no remainder.

Since 1,125,534 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,125,534, it is a composite number.
